Fig. 4From: Chronic lung disease in paediatric patients: Does magnetic resonance imaging has a role?A 10-year-old female diagnosed as interstitial pulmonary fibrosis (usual interstitial pneumonia), T2 blade, and comparable HRCT cut; both show bilateral fairly symmetrical basal reticulations, interlobular septal thickening, traction bronchiolectasis (blue arrows), bronchial wall thickening, and honeycombing (black arrows). CT score 18, MRI score 20Back to article page
